* Set all valuators for relative motion events (#24737)Bartosz Brachaczek2009-11-20
| | | | | | | | | | | | | | | | | | | We should process all the deltas reported by a relative motion device, otherwise some devices such as A4Tech X-750F or similar may trigger a situation when the `v` array contains random values (it isn't initialized anywhere) and later we process them and in effect the mouse cursor "jumps" on the screen. I'm not sure why, but we also must be sure that the `first` and `last` variables reflect the axis map, otherwise the mouse cursor "jumps" on the screen when clicking mouse buttons in some rare cases reported by Bartek Iwaniec on Bugzilla. That's why a simple initialization of the `v` array with zeros isn't sufficient. * Relax checks when reopening devicesDmitry Torokhov2009-11-20
| | | | | | | | | | | | | | | | | | | | | | When checking whether we are dealing with the same device as before when we try to reopen it evdev should not require exact match of entire keymap. Users should be allowed to adjust keymaps to better match their hardware even after X starts. However we don't expect changes in [BTN_MISC, KEY_OK) range since these codes are reserved for mice, joysticks, tablets and so forth, so we will limit the check to this range. The same goes for absinfo - limits can change and it should not result in device being disabled. Also check the length of the data returned by ioctl and don't try to compare more than we were given. * Convert IgnoreAbsolute/RelativeAxes options into trinary state.Peter Hutterer2009-10-15
| | | | | | | | | | | | | | | | | | | | | | | | | | | | | The Xen Virtual Pointer device exports both absolute and relative axes from the kernel device. Which coordinates are used is a run-time decision and depends on the host-specific configuration. 0a3657d2ee62f4086e9687218cb33835ba61a0b3 broke these devices, and they are now unusable out-of-the-box as there is no configuration to cover them. This patch converts the IgnoreAbsoluteAxes and the IgnoreRelativeAxes configuration options into a trinary state. 1. If unset, configure the device as normal by trying to guess the right axis setup. 2. If set to true, ignore the specific axis type completely (except for wheel events). 3. If set to false, explicitly 'unignore' the axis type, alwas configuring it if it is present on the device. This setting introduces seemingly buggy behaviour (see Bug 21832) 1. and 2. replicate the current driver behaviour. The result of 3. is that is that if a device has absolute axes and the options set to false, both axes will be initialized (absolute last to get clipping right). This requires axis labelling priorty to switch from relative first to absolute first. Relative events are forwarded into the server through the absolute axes, the server scales this into the device absolute range and everyone is happy. * Add explicit options to ignore relative or absolute axes.Peter Hutterer2009-10-07
| | | | | | | | | | | | | | | The X server cannot deal with devices that have both relative and absolute axes. Evdev tries to guess wich axes to ignore given the device type and disables absolute axes for mice and relative axes for tablets, touchscreens and touchpad. This guess is sometimes wrong and causes exitus felis domesticae parvulae. Two new configuration options are provided to explicitly allow ignoring an axis. Mouse wheel axes are exempt and will work even if relative axes are ignored. No property, this option must be set in the configuration. * Restrict wheel emulation to a single axis at a time.Peter Hutterer2009-08-18
| | | | | | | | | | | | | | | | Wheel emulation works for both horizontal and vertical axes. Thus, if a device doesn't move in perfect straight line, scroll events build up on the respective other axis. In some clients, scroll wheel events have specific meanings other than scrolling (e.g. mplayer). In these clients, erroneous scrolling events come at a high cost. Thus, if a scroll wheel event is generated for one axis, reset the inertia of the other axis to 0, avoiding the buildup of these erroneous scrolling events. * evdev.c: Fix/improve discrimination of rel/abs axesMichael Witten2009-08-06
| |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| The relevant comment from evdev.c: We don't allow relative and absolute axes on the same device. The reason is that some devices (MS Optical Desktop 2000) register both rel and abs axes for x/y. The abs axes register min/max; this min/max then also applies to the relative device (the mouse) and caps it at 0..255 for both axes. So, unless you have a small screen, you won't be enjoying it much; consequently, absolute axes are generally ignored. However, currenly only a device with absolute axes can be registered as a touch{pad,screen}. Thus, given such a device, absolute axes are used and relative axes are ignored. * evdev: Only send the events at synchronization time.Oliver McFadden2009-07-29
| | | | | | | | | | | | | | | | | | | Instead of just posting the button/key press/release events to the server as soon as they arrive, add them to an internal queue and post them once we receive an EV_SYN synchronization event. The motion events are always sent first, followed by the queued events. There will be one motion event and possibly many queued button/key events posted every EV_SYN event. Note that the size of the event queue (EVDEV_MAXQUEUE) is arbitrary and you may change it. If we receive more events than the queue can handle, those events are dropped and a warning message printed. * Ensure enough buttons are advertised to pass the button mapping.Peter Hutterer2009-05-21
| | | | | | | | | | | | | | | | Some buttons are mapped to higher button numbers. For example, BTN_0 is posted as button 8 if BTN_LEFT is present. On top of that, the driver-specific button mapping may map the button to something else again. We need to take these mappings into account when counting the number of buttons on the device. Example: A device with BTN_LEFT and BTN_0 and a mapping from 1 -> 7 and 8 -> 2. BTN_LEFT is mapped to 1. 1 is mapped to 7. num_buttons is 7. BTN_0 is mapped to 8. 8 is mapped to 2. num_buttons remains 7. Signed-off-by: Peter Hutterer <peter.hutterer@who-t.net>
